Development of the Industrial Emission Control
of the Stationary Sources of Air Pollution |
Emelyanchikov V.I.
Eliseenko Yu.Yu.
The article describes the facility meant for the measurement of pollutant concentration field and the velocity field of gas flow. The facility allows to reduce the labor input and to improve the measurement accuracy of contaminant concentration, gas flow velocity as well as emission rate by means of portable measuring devices and continuous emission monitoring systems. This is achieved through the implementation of: a) simultaneous measurement of 4 values (concentration, speed, temperature, pressure), by setting the shifting gear manually at the measuring point at any section of the emission source; b) measurement of emissions of polluting substances (PS) with one set of measuring instruments (MI), which consists of a Prandtl tube, a thermocouple, a millivoltmeter, a portable or transportable gas analyzer, at 3, 5 or 10 emission sources, equipped with an application; c) regular public and industrial monitoring of emissions of polluting substances at levels of up to +50 m of smokestacks and mains gas ducts; d) sampling for instrumental and laboratory control method in the finding point of the measuring section, where the concentration of polluting substances is approximately equal to the average concentration in the section.
